Basic Vector Information
- Vector Name:
- pCAG-Gal4VP16-2A-TagBFP-2A-Bla
- Antibiotic Resistance:
- Ampicillin
- Length:
- 9890 bp
- Type:
- Cloning vector
- Replication origin:
- ori
- Source/Author:
- Li Y, Jiang Y, Chen H, Liao W, Li Z, Weiss R, Xie Z.
- Promoter:
- chicken β-actin
